Autodesk DWF Toolkit
11 June 08 03:42 PM
Autodesk has announced version 7.5 of the Autodesk DWF Toolkit which now supports XPS-based DWFx files. The toolkit, for Windows and Linux, supports DWF files from AutoCAD 2009 and other Autodesk design software applications. Download

Océ announce XPS Device Support
09 June 08 06:34 PM
Océ has announced two new color MFPs with XPS support, the cm2522 and cm3522: Users will have the capability to move information more rapidly throughout the entire organization by seamlessly integrating with existing network infrastructure.

XPS Mimic
09 June 08 06:27 PM
Madcap Software has announced Mimic 2.0, a software simulation tool, with support for output to Silverlight and XPS.
